Analysis Of Seismic Response Of A Large Chassis Twin Towers Structure With Transfer Story

With the progress of science and technology and the development of the times,high-rise buildings have been developed rapidly.This diversification requirements,set a different column or wall in the vertical position of the structure,so the structure in the upper space lower small space is arranged in the conversion layer.The conversion layer is the building of key parts of the force,in practical engineering,because the conversion layer in the form of a variety of treatment,often according to the experience of using,however different forms of transformations for seismic response and seismic performance of the overall structure has a great influence.In this paper,the large chassis Twin Towers connecting structure with transfer floor is taken as the object of study.Theoretical analysis and numerical simulation are used as the main research work.According to the shaking table test model and the Xu Qinghai thesis,3D finite element analysis model is established by ETABS numerical simulation,the numerical simulation results and experimental results are compared and validated by using the model of this paper.The vertical position of the structural transfer story in the large chassis Twin Towers joint structure is adjusted,and the seismic analysis of the structure model is carried out.Comparison of different position conversion layer structure period and the vibration type,base shear structure,the layers of seismic force,impact structure interlayer displacement angle and the structure of the special parts of the internal force and so on,and offer a reference to structure design.By adjusting the structural form of the structural transfer story,six large chassis Twin Towers connecting models with transfer storey are established,and the six models are three single-layer transition truss models and three laminated transition truss models respectively.Modal analysis and elastic time history analysis of the established structural model are carried out,and a better model is selected to make the structure more reasonable and provide a reference for the relevant structural design.The conversion model of laminated cross truss(truss by cross conversion to the adjacent position of the extension of a cross)is a good selection of Twin Towers and large chassis floor truss form theconnecting structure with conversion layer,and the best set in three or four layers.
